
Dual-channel AC-input, DC-output optocoupler featuring transistor output. This through-hole mounted component is housed in a 4-pin PDIP package with a 2.54mm pin pitch. It offers a minimum isolation voltage of 5000 Vrms, a minimum current transfer ratio of 50%, and operates within a temperature range of -25°C to 85°C. Key electrical specifications include a maximum collector-emitter voltage of 55V and a maximum collector current of 50mA.
